TURN-208: Gatevale turnstile counters at the Merrow Field pilot double-count when a rotation reverses mid-cycle. Attendance totals drift roughly 2% high per event. The debounce window fix is implemented, reviewed by Ilsa, and soak-tested across two simulated match days without drift. Ready for your cut; the candidate build is identified below.

trace token, tagag-tafog: htk6_5ed18c

Subject: Shipfee cut-over — done!

Hi Tovan, welcome aboard. Quick summary since you missed the fun: we cut the Parcelwright shipping-fee rules engine over to the new evaluator on Tuesday night. No customer-facing hiccups, one brief spike in rule-cache misses that self-healed. Old engine stays in shadow mode for two weeks, so don't delete anything yet. For your local setup, the engine expects these settings:

settings of fafog-haduf:
ZORIX_PIN=4648
ZORIX_METRICS_HOST=metrics.zorix.paliqsys.corp
ZORIX_LOG_LEVEL=info
ZORIX_TENANT=druix

Fraction rollout of the FareLadder pricing experiment proceeds in three stages: 5%, 25%, then full. Before each stage, verify the holdout cohort in the Tolvane dashboard remains untouched and that refund rates stay within the agreed guardrail. All experiment config bundles must be signed prior to upload. The current deploy key for signing FareLadder bundles follows.

release key, kawif-hawep: bky13_X7TGuRG4Zu4ZJ

**Handover: Flagwright rollout framework**

Hey folks — Flagwright is in decent shape. Percentage rollouts work; the kill-switch path is tested but the audit log lags ~30s, so don't trust it mid-incident. Marla has context on the targeting DSL if you get stuck. To unlock the staging admin console for your first deploy, use the recovery passphrase below.

unlock words, tawif-tahop: oliys-ulawyn-tamdor-lamys-casox-jormir-fraius-kasath-ulador-ulamir-holir-sorys-holeth